Innovations in Precision Surgery

Robotic-assisted surgery is transforming the way surgeons approach joint replacement procedures. These systems offer unsurpassed precision, enabling personalized treatment plans based on 3D imaging of the affected joint. Robotic systems help refine surgical accuracy during procedures such as hip and knee arthroplasties. When combined with advanced imaging, this technology contributes to more precise implant positioning, aiding in better long-term results.

Surgeons also have tools that allow them to perform minimally invasive procedures, which may lead to reduced post-operative discomfort and shorter recovery times. These advanced techniques often involve smaller incisions and precise instruments, minimizing the impact on surrounding tissues. As a result, patients can resume their normal activities more quickly and with fewer complications.

Improvements in Implant Materials

The design and composition of implants used in arthroplasty continue to advance significantly. These developments are driven by the need to improve patient outcomes and meet the demands of a more active population. Modern materials have been engineered to provide greater durability and enhanced wear resistance. This helps reduce the risk of implant degradation over time. These advancements are especially beneficial for younger, more active individuals undergoing joint replacement.

Implant designs have also evolved to better replicate the natural movement of joints, incorporating features that mimic the biomechanics of the human body. This improvement allows for smoother, more fluid motion post-surgery, enhancing the overall quality of life for patients. Research and development efforts continue to prioritize not only durability but also patient comfort and natural joint function.

Enhanced Recovery and Rehabilitation

Recovery and rehabilitation strategies are key to a successful joint replacement, helping patients regain mobility and improve their quality of life. Innovations like personalized rehab protocols are revolutionizing this process. These advancements allow healthcare providers to monitor progress and adjust treatment plans as needed, helping patients get the right care at every stage of recovery.

Enhanced recovery pathways accelerate healing with personalized approaches tailored to each patient’s needs, lifestyle, and goals. These strategies often focus on helping patients regain mobility faster. They also help reduce the risk of complications or setbacks with constant care and monitoring.

Coordinated rehabilitation programs typically bring together a team of healthcare professionals to provide patients with seamless care during recovery. With a focus on personalized strategies, these programs help patients regain independence more quickly. They cover all aspects of recovery, including physical therapy and emotional support, providing comprehensive care every step of the way.
